Bay Area Maker Faire 2008
Saturday May 3, 2008 - Sunday May 4, 2008
San Mateo County Expo Center
2495 S Delaware St
San Mateo, California 94403 Get Directions
Maker Faire is a two-day, family-friendly event that celebrates the Do-It-Yourself (DIY) mindset. It’s for creative, resourceful people of all ages and backgrounds who like to tinker and love to make things.
